WebFeb 12, 2014 · Over the years, many Amateur Radio operators have successfully used a metal roof as the ground plane or radial system for their HF vertical antenna. This is possible with a metal roof on a home, barn, garage, carport, RV, porch and metal sheds or awnings, and even on commercial buildings. The 160 meter band isn't that wide, so the tuner in the Elecraft K4D easily tunes up the antenna ... easily digestible high protein foodsWebA lower resistivity means you will need less of a metal to reduce the resistance to an acceptable target. Here's a selection, ordered from lowest to highest resistivity in nano-ohm-meters (nΩm), of some metals you might consider using in an antenna: Silver: 15.9. Copper: 16.8. Gold: 24.4. Aluminium: 26.2. Zinc: 59.0. easily disgusted shockedWebA rotorized (pointable) antenna is preferable to a stationary antenna. A fixed-position FM antenna should be pointed toward Blue Hill Mountain.
